(c) The advantages of zero-based budgeting are as follows: (i) It provides a systematic approach for the evaluation of different activities and rank them in order of preference for the allocation of scarce resources. (ii) It ensures that the various functions undertaken by the organization are critical for the achievement of its objectives and are being performed in the best possible way. (iii) It provides an opportunity to the management to allocate resources for various activities only after having a thorough cost-benefit-analysis. The chances of arbitrary cuts and enhancement are thus avoided. (iv) The areas of wasteful expenditure can be easily identified and eliminated. (v) Departmental budgets are closely linked with corporation objectives.

TOPPER S INSTITUTE [COSTING] RTP 26 (vi) The technique can also be used for the introduction and implementation of the system of management by objective. Thus, it cannot only be used for fulfillment of the objectives of traditional budgeting but it can also be used for a variety of other purposes. (d) This product costing system is used when an entity produces more than one variant of final product using different materials but with similar conversion activities. Which means conversion activities are similar for all the product variants but materials differ significantly. Operation Costing method is also known as Hybrid product costing system as materials costs are accumulated by job order or batch wise but conversion costs i.e. labour and overheads costs are accumulated by department, and process costing methods are used to assign these costs to products. Moreover, under operation costing, conversion costs are applied to products using a predetermined application rate. This predetermined rate is based on budgeted conversion costs. The two example of industries are Ready made garments and Jewellery making. Total 7,40,88,985.44-1,29,45,899.56 Ans. 5 (a) Accounting treatment of idle time wages & overtime wages in cost accounts: Normal idle time is treated as a part of the cost of production. Thus, in the case of direct workers, an allowance for normal idle time is built into the labour cost rates. In the case of indirect workers, normal idle time is spread over air the products or jobs through the process of absorption of factory overheads. Under Cost Accounting, the overtime premium is treated as follows: If overtime is resorted to, at the desire of the customer, then the overtime premium may be charged to the job directly.

TOPPER S INSTITUTE [COSTING] RTP 32 If overtime is required to cope with general production program or for meeting urgent orders, the overtime premium should be treated as overhead cost of particular department or cost center which works overtime. Overtime worked on account of abnormal conditions should be charged to costing Profit & Loss Account. If overtime is worked in a department due to the fault of another department the overtime premium should be charged to the latter department (b) Problems of controlling the selling & distribution overheads are: (i) (ii) (iii) The incidence of selling & distribution overheads depends on external factors such as distance of market, nature of competition etc. which are beyond the control of management. (c) (i) (ii) (d) Discretionary Cost Centre: The cost centre whose output cannot be measured in financial terms, thus input-output ratio cannot be defined. The cost of input is compared with allocated budget for the activity. Example of discretionary cost centres are Research & Development department, Advertisement department where output of these department cannot be measured with certainty and co - related with cost incurred on inputs. Investment Centres: These are the responsibility centres which are not only responsible for profitability but also has the authority to make capital investment decisions. The performance of these responsibility centres are measured on the basis of Return on Investment (ROI) besides profit. Examples of investment centres are Maharatna, Navratna and Miniratna companies of Public Sector Undertakings of Central Government. Cost plus contracts have the following advantages: (i) The Contractor is assured of a fixed percentage of profit. There is no risk of incurring any loss on the contract. (ii) It is useful specially when the work to be done is not definitely fixed at the time of making the estimate. (iii) Contractee can ensure himself about the cost of the contract, as he is empowered to examine the books and documents of the contractor to ascertain the veracity of the cost of the contract. (c) Both bin cards and stores ledger are perpetual inventory records. None of them is a substitute for the other. These two records may be distinguished from the following points of view: (i) Bin cards are maintained by the store keeper, while the stores ledger is maintained by the cost accounting department. (ii) Bin card is the stores recording document whereas the stores ledger is an accounting record. (iii) Bin card contains information with regard to quantities i.e. their receipt, issue and balance while the stores ledger contains both quantitative and value information in respect of their receipts, issue and balance. (iv) In the bin card entries are made at the time when transaction takes place. But in the stores ledger entries are made only after the transaction has taken place. (v) Inter departmental transfer of materials appear only in stores ledger.
